Draw the condensed structural formula for alkane or line angle formula cycloalkane for each of the following:

  1. Methane
  2. Ethane
  3. Butane
  4. Cyclopropane

Step-by-Step Solution

Verified
Answer

Structural formulas of compounds are:

  1. CH4: Methane
  2. H3C-CH3: Ethane
  3. H3C-CH2-CH2-CH3: Butane
